President Bola Tinubu has officially disavowed the proliferation of 2027 campaign billboards and promotional materials bearing his and Vice President Kashim Shettima’s images across Nigeria. The Presidency emphasized that these activities are unauthorized and contravene the nation's electoral laws.
In a statement released on Sunday, April 13, 2025, Special Adviser to the President on Information and Strategy, Bayo Onanuga, expressed dismay over the increasing number of such billboards, particularly in Abuja and Kano. He clarified that neither President Tinubu nor Vice President Shettima has endorsed any campaign activities for the 2027 elections. Onanuga stressed that premature campaigning is illegal and undermines the integrity of the electoral process.
The Presidency called on individuals and groups responsible for these unauthorized campaign materials to cease immediately. It reiterated that political campaigns are only permissible after the Independent National Electoral Commission (INEC) releases the official timetable for elections.
President Tinubu and Vice President Shettima remain committed to their current mandate, focusing on economic revitalization, human capital development, infrastructural renewal, social investment, and national security. The administration urges all supporters to respect the rule of law and await official announcements regarding future political campaigns.
